Product Policy Manager - Product Advising

About the Team

The Product Policy team is responsible for the development, implementation, enforcement, and communication of the policies that govern use of OpenAI’s services, including ChatGPT, GPTs, the GPT store, Sora, and the OpenAI API. As a member of this team, you will be instrumental in developing policy approaches to best enable both innovative and responsible use of AI so that our groundbreaking technologies are truly used to benefit all people. 

 

About the Role

As a Product Policy advisor and early member of the Product Policy team, you will provide direct policy support to product teams as they launch new products and features. You will leverage an understanding of AI technology, consumer and developer products, as well as the policy landscape to help mitigate risks and ensure OpenAI’s products benefit all of humanity.

We’re looking for people who have previously worked in product policy roles - ideally in generative AI - and are experienced in collaborating closely with technical teams. Ideal candidates will have a depth of understanding of the AI policy landscape and will translate this knowledge into actionable, prioritized advice for product teams and company leadership. As OpenAI continues to grow, this role must quickly and effectively align diverse teams and stakeholders. Experience driving alignment across a range of functions (product, legal, research, intelligence teams, global affairs, communications) will be essential. Ideal candidates will be comfortable with a high degree of ambiguity.

This role is based in San Francisco, CA. We use a hybrid work model of 3 days in the office per week and offer relocation assistance to new employees.

In this role, you will:

  • Provide tailored policy advice to product teams based on a deep understanding of and empathy for the technical and business goals of the product, as well as a clear assessment of policy considerations.

  • Collaborate cross-functionally with teams across the company, including legal, integrity, ops, safety, communications, and others. You will translate public policy considerations for technical teams, and vice versa. 

  • Develop clear risk assessments for new AI products and features and prioritize across them. Provide operationalizable implementation standards and enforcement protocols for partner teams to leverage.

  • Identify opportunities to leverage data to inform our policy work.

 

You might thrive in this role if you:

  • Have worked 7+ years in a product policy role at a tech company, ideally working on generative AI products

  • Possess excellent communication skills with demonstrated ability to communicate with product managers, engineers, researchers, and executives alike

  • Are comfortable with ambiguity and enjoy going 0 to 1

  • Are a creative thinker with an eye for opportunities to leverage data to inform policies

OpenAI is an AI research and deployment company dedicated to ensuring that general-purpose artificial intelligence benefits all of humanity. We push the boundaries of the capabilities of AI systems and seek to safely deploy them to the world through our products. AI is an extremely powerful tool that must be created with safety and human needs at its core, and to achieve our mission, we must encompass and value the many different perspectives, voices, and experiences that form the full spectrum of humanity.
